Typical Costs for Electrician Services in West Groton, Massachusetts
The cost of electrician services can vary depending on the complexity of the job, the materials required, and the electrician’s hourly rates. Here is a general estimate for common services in the West Groton area:
| Service |
Estimated Cost Range |
| Hourly Rate (General Electrician) |
$75 – $150 |
| Outlet Installation/Repair |
$100 – $300 |
| Light Fixture Installation |
$150 – $400 |
| Circuit Breaker Replacement |
$200 – $500 |
| Electrical Panel Upgrade |
$1,500 – $4,000+ |
| Generator Installation |
$3,000 – $7,000+ |
Note: These are approximate costs and can fluctuate based on specific circumstances and local market rates. It is always recommended to get a detailed quote from multiple electricians.
Frequently Asked Questions About Electrician Services in West Groton
Q1: My lights are flickering in my older house in West Groton. What could be the cause?
A1: Flickering lights in older homes can stem from several issues, including loose wiring connections, an overloaded circuit, a faulty light bulb or fixture, or problems with the electrical panel itself. Given the prevalence of older homes in West Groton, it’s often an issue with aging wiring or connections that need professional assessment and repair to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Q2: How often should I have my electrical system inspected in West Groton?
A2: It’s generally recommended to have your electrical system inspected every 3-5 years for homeowners, and annually for commercial properties. However, if your home is over 20 years old, has undergone major renovations, or if you notice any signs of electrical problems like frequent breaker trips or discolored outlets, an inspection sooner rather than later is advisable.
Q3: I’m considering installing a new ceiling fan in my living room. What are the typical steps involved for an electrician?
A3: An electrician will first assess whether your current ceiling electrical box can support the weight and electrical load of the new fan. If not, they’ll need to install a fan-rated box or reinforce the existing one. They will then safely disconnect the old lighting fixture, run new wiring if necessary, connect the fan according to the manufacturer’s instructions and electrical codes, and ensure all connections are secure and properly grounded. They’ll also test the fan and its light to ensure everything operates correctly.
